Vet Clearance Required - Hierarchal - Warwick Farm (Wed)

Race 5 Number 13: Co-Trainer Mr A Cummings has advised Stewards that Hierarchal sustained an injury to its near fore heel on Saturday morning, 26 May 2018, which required treatment.

Hierarchal has subsequently been withdrawn from Kembla Grange tomorrow, 29 May 2018 on veterinary advice.

Mr Cummings has further advised it is the stable's intention for the horse to fulfil its engagement at Warwick Farm on Wednesday 30 May 2018.

Mr Cummings was told that a veterinary clearance will be required by close of business tomorrow if the gelding is to start.

Hierarchal will be inspected by Racing NSW veterinarians upon arrival at Warwick Farm Racecourse on Wednesday.
